当遇到“swagger failed to fetch”的问题时,这通常意味着Swagger UI无法从服务器获取API文档。以下是一些可能的解决步骤,你可以按照这些步骤逐一排查问题: 确认Swagger环境配置是否正确: 确保你的Swagger UI配置正确指向了API文档的位置。例如,如果你使用的是Springfox(一个Java库,用于为Spring应用自动生成Swagger文档)...
今天验证一个微服务框架的适用性,框架集成的Swagger发请求时提示如下异常,借此机会对CORS(跨域资源共享)了解一二: Failed to fetch. Possible Reasons: CORS Network Failure URL scheme must be “http” or “https” for CORS request 关于CORS(跨域资源共享)的详细解读: https://developer.mozilla.org/zh-CN/do...
gin 使用swagger 测试接口错误 TypeError: Failed to fetch 回到顶部 解决方案 找到项目中的的docs.go文件 将host 改为你程序的端口和ip,例如localhost:8080。 可能你的BasePath不是/v2,所以需要改成你的BasePath,例如我的是api。 ===更新 直接更新这个地方,然后swag init就不需要手动修改了。
注意注意注意:这里配置的是http;别有的配置http,有的配置https;
nginx + swagger 碰撞出TypeError: Failed to fetch 折腾了很久才解决,记录一下实验经过 wxg.com是我在本地配置的映射,对应localhost 后台采用 spring boot + spring-session + redis ,很简单的一个应用, 就是通过/set/{name}设置一个变量存储到session中, ...
简介:解决swagger提示Failed to load API definition Fetch errorundefined 直接提上问题图片: 首先保证Swagger配置没有错,具体可以参考之前写的博客:《淘东电商项目(05) - Swagger及网关统一管理API》 如果还有问题,最大的可能是端口被禁止访问了,只要在Linux服务器设置开放端口即可(比如开放10086端口):...
Get error: TypeError: Failed to fetch Environment All supported DevTest releases. Cause Registry is configured for SSL. so the Invoke API URL is HTTPS. https://abcd.nam.nsroot.net:1505/lisa-virtualize-invoke/api/v3/swagger-ui The Scheme used is HTTP and that caused the Fetch Error. ...
当尝试通过swaggerUI运行请求时,我在Swagger上收到以下响应TypeError:Failedtofetch在搜索之后,我发现这个错误的一个可能的原因是CORS问题,在请求中更改了原点该API在默认网站上作为应用程序运行,并通过以下url访问: http://servername/application-name/swagger/index.html 任何人都可以帮助解决这个问题吗?
在linux环境下,vim是常用的代码查看和编辑工具。在程序编译出错时,一般会提示出错的行号,但是用vim打开...
SwaggerUI: TypeError: Failed to fetch 过了一段时间之后。我的swagger也不能使用了,我使用F12进行调试,发现swagger请求的地址是localhost,瞬间明白了,之前请求成功的原因是因为我本地的项目也是启动了的 fine ,在我将nginx的配置文件的localhost直接改成了ip地址,问题成功的解决了(没有学计算机网络的难受之处)...